Type
ORACLE
Validation date
2024-04-05 15:08: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03461,
    "usd": 0.03741
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010843EB852FE2F4A0287C4BB4DBFB9A63DF63162CBA9FBAAF67BE615D0C768EAC

Previous signature

044BD2BB7F6FB1E8A45DB0FD319E29DD6C8EAF23524CB92334178DF44CE7CF8537A01053465E2D835A877A0D29990972EC7BEAF2E988E71A9A4068A1DFB56303

Origin signature

3045022100CFBCD87847D1EBC4AC94739A3FB3A581502947C8DE02CF59A374B04BC62A6C9A02204B0911E58E1B982D3323B47DEB1B486FF4874C67EFBEDF6041CDB11490FE4266

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0015779EF4EE923777F9AA58B5C9FE62E8FF5157201C313903BC8114730CE53A82

Coordinator signature

A803F9E28ED666395D57C899087FE29DD0A669D35B6DCEE1C57F58B80D83D9E6222E2A6A28950380A9F047F25E2BA864DB898F6E26BC58C817D50307980F9F06

Validator #1 public key

000105433F0B53A0F5EE146F7C7FE9CC784E3578C950889E786888DE0650B09E1DC0

Validator #1 signature

D1EA3513EFB9CB33812CC7758BD38E76CA1B6746F6AF013D806DAF822E78DF779AE2A1848FFE52CCD886AF89088927ADB8A119498CE7EC5A5BC6052BE66D8701

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

906DC1385AF6B1354A56156D4EE4B4523A96D75BBC157F64CB871509990F65789F4E3E0CB5C4B18858DCBC35F2094F0A9A89AF50F96F47E514D63599E4BAFD01